Output 573dd3d669ab10381e43c97a795752156cf035ede1051601e20c0f52c853dcf4:0

value
3812667
script pubkey
OP_0 OP_PUSHBYTES_20 450928fc4ce8cadfb07e6c591fd2103467633835
address
bc1qg5yj3lzvar9dlvr7d3v3l5ssx3nkxwp4njn2x3
transaction
573dd3d669ab10381e43c97a795752156cf035ede1051601e20c0f52c853dcf4
confirmations
2155
spent
true